Despite 10 years old, League of Legends is still the world's most successful PC game, regularly taking the #1 spot on SuperdataResearch's highest grossing PC games list. While we haven't seen any official stats from Riot Games in sometime, they did come out today and say that the game hits 8 million peak concurrent players daily.

Every day we see about 8 million peak concurrent players in League.* That makes League the biggest PC game in the world—it's even bigger than the top ten games on Steam combined. While Fortnite may be bigger if you combine its playerbase on PC, Console, and Mobile, League of Legends is the single biggest PC game in the world. Fortnite reportedly reaches 8.3M peak concurrent users across all platforms and that figure hit over 10M during the Mashmello concert.
